ÊÔһϰ¡£¬ ½²¾¿×ÅÓ㺠A factor is that the friction coefficient (f) is proportional to the pressure drop. The pulsating flow is composed of a steady flow superimposed with a forced vibration flow, and changes periodically with time, which in turn causes the pressure drop to show periodic changes, hence the friction coefficient (f) gives the periodic changes. The friction coefficient hardly changes if the fluid flow is kept constant under the stationary flow field. |
